Small Groups at Providence Presbyterian Church

 

Small Groups are ideal places for newcomers and those seeking to better understand the Christian faith to connect. They are the way we do ministry here at Providence and are open to anyone regardless of their faith commitment or membership status in the church. The atmosphere of a Small Group is warm and nonthreatening because most groups meet in the relaxed setting of someone’s home. Our Small Groups are an important part of ministry here at Providence Church because they provide an environment where Christ ministers to and through us, where relationships are nurtured and where people care and look to the concerns of others. These groups provide opportunities for the use and development of spiritual gifts for the building up of the body of Christ and encourage us to live God-pleasing lives. There are currently seven groups meeting in various locations in York County. Meeting dates, times and locations are listed each week in the bulletin.
